Commission approves multiple hires, staffing-plan changes, merit increases and county banking policy
Summary
The commission approved hiring and transfers in the sheriff's office and solid waste department, amended staffing plans, authorized an internal job reclassification, and approved county banking and investment policies and merit increases.

The Limestone County Commission approved a block of personnel actions, amended staffing plans, and county financial policies during its meeting.
The commission approved multiple hires pending background screenings: Garrett Brown as a deputy sheriff; Stephen Chapman as a solid waste truck driver (effective date not specified in the meeting record); Christopher Carter as a solid waste truck driver effective June 16; Eddie Jeffers as a solid waste operator effective June 3; and Shelby Moran as a commission clerk (start date to be determined). The motions were grouped and approved on a single voice vote.
Commissioners also approved transfers retroactive to April 18: Robert Moores from deputy sergeant to patrol lieutenant; Justice Smith from NSRO to patrol sergeant; and Bradley Fontenot from patrol deputy to patrol sergeant. The commission approved an amendment to the solid waste staffing plan to remove one part-time laborer and add one truck operator (increasing truck operators from 11 to 12), and to the administrative staffing plan to remove one purchasing clerk and add an additional commission clerk (increasing commission clerks from 1 to 2).
The commission approved moving Hannah Scribe from purchasing technician to communications and media facilitator effective in June (exact date not specified). The commission also approved county banking and investment policies and a slate of merit increases; no dollar amounts for merit increases or the banking policy details were provided in the transcript.
